Strawberry Cake

Ingredients

– 2 cups all-purpose flour
– 1 ½ cups granulated sugar
– 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
– 1 cup milk
– 3 large eggs
– 2 teaspoons baking powder
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– ½ teaspoon salt
– 1 cup fresh strawberries, pureed
– 1 cup whipped cream for frosting
– Extra strawberries for decoration

Servings and Cooking Time

This recipe makes 8 servings. Preparation time is about 15 minutes, and cooking time is around 30 minutes, totaling 45 minutes.

Nutritional Value

Each serving (1 slice) contains approximately 250 calories, 10g fat, 34g carbohydrates, 2g protein, and 15g sugar. This information is based on one serving.

Step-by-Step Cooking Process

1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ans.
3. In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
4.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.
5. Stir in the vanilla extract and strawberry puree.
6. In another b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, and salt.
7.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, alternating with milk.
8. Mix until just combined; do not overmix.
9. Pour the batter evenly into the prepared pans.
10.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.

Alternative Ingredients

You can substitute all-purpose flour with almond flour for a gluten-free version. Additionally, replace granulated sugar with coconut sugar for a healthier option. Fresh strawberries can also be swapped with other berries like raspberries or blueberries.

Serving and Pairings

This strawberry cake pairs wonderfully with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a dollop of whipped cream. It can also be served with a refreshing fruit salad or a cup of herbal tea for a delightful afternoon treat.

Storage and Reheating

Store any leftover strawberry cake in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. For longer storage, you can freeze the cake for up to 2 months. To reheat, simply let it thaw in the refrigerator overnight and serve at room temperature.

FAQs

How can I make this cake gluten-free?

You can substitute the all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end. Ensure the baking powder is also gluten-free for the best results.

Can I use frozen strawberries?

Yes, you can use frozen strawberries, but be sure to thaw and drain them well to avoid excess moisture in the batter.

How long does the cake last?

The cake can last up to 3 days in the refrigerator or up to 2 months if frozen. Make sure it’s stored properly to maintain freshness.
